Want to see a snapshot of your duties?
Parcel Control Tower (Outbound & Inbound Parcels)
Daily tracking of outbound and inbound parcel movements, including scan health, delays, and exceptions
Liaising directly with carriers to triage and resolve delivery failures, address issues, and improve transit performance
Producing weekly carrier scorecards with key metrics (e.g. OTD%, claims, cost per parcel)
Claims Management
Preparing and submitting loss or damage claims with supporting documentation
Maintaining a detailed credits ledger and analysing root causes of claim denials
Inbound Planning Support
Assisting with turning the weekly inbound plan into actionable daily load and slot bookings
Coordinating with freight forwarders, hauliers, and 3PLs
Providing cover during annual leave periods for the Logistics Lead and the wider Supply Chain & Logistics team
PO Reconciliation & Invoice Checks
Performing post-delivery checks against purchase orders for quantity, value, and service
Logging PODs and maintaining audit-ready documentation
Issue Logging & Continuous Improvement
Logging operational concerns into our CIACAR system with assigned actions and due dates
Chasing open items to resolution, tracking overdue issues, and escalating where needed
Publishing weekly CIACAR status digests
Stakeholder Support
Acting as the first point of contact for internal teams and stores for logistics queries, delivery exceptions, and claims
Logging non-compliance issues and following up to resolution

The Pavers story began in York in 1971 when Catherine Paver took out a 200 bank loan (for a sofa she told them) to fund her new business. She had big dreams of changing the world of footwear and a passion to provide comfortable and stylish shoes for all.
Starting small, she sold shoes at village halls and homeware parties before opening the first Pavers shop in Scarborough in 1981, when Catherine's three sons joined the business. One of her sons, Stuart, ran the business as Managing Director for over 40 years, joined by his son Jason in 2016. As of September 2023, Jason Paver is now the Managing Director of Pavers Ltd, with Stuart Paver moving to Chairman, taking the company into the 3rd generation of family run leadership.
From these modest beginnings, Pavers Shoes has grown to be a UK leader in today's footwear industry, with over 180 stores nationwide encompassing our more recently acquired brands including Jones Bootmaker, Herring Shoes, Padders & Van Dal.
We remain acquisitive, highly profitable, and are an ever-growing, independent family-run business, employing over 1,900 people.
